Jonathan Cheng has over 12 years of experience in the pension field with prior experience as a senior actuarial analyst for Watson and Wyatt. He has performed annual pension and post-retirement medical valuations for a variety of clients, including eleven Fortune 500 companies that cover more than 20,000 participants in each Defined Benefit Plan. Other actuarial skills and knowledge include calculating plan liabilities, annual accounting expenses, cash contributions, funded status and PBGC premiums necessary for pension, retiree healthcare, and retiree life insurance benefits. Throughout Jonathan's career he has completed various special projects as required by his clients, including merger and acquisition, union negotiation analysis, executive retirement plan design, and government regulations compliance plan design.
